Not as such, the winning team get 40 medals to give out to players/staff as they see fit as long as every player who has made at least 5 appearances gets one.

They get 40 medals to give out and only 29 players have featured in 5 or more games. Carson apparently always gets one. As will Guardiola. Don’t know who gets the remaining 9. Kalvin Phillips? The Assistant Manager?
